Why the 25‑to‑60 Swap Is Nothing More Than a Numbers Game
The headline promises a modest £25 deposit that magically turns into £60 play credit. In practice, it’s a meticulously calibrated piece of arithmetic designed to hide a hefty wagering requirement. The operator lifts the deposit by a factor of 2.4, then straps on a 30‑times rollover that most players never clear. It feels generous until you realise you’re essentially paying £25 for a £60 bankroll that you must gamble away before touching a penny.

Take the typical scenario: you hand over £25, the casino adds a £35 “bonus” and you end up with £60. The moment you click “accept”, the bonus amount is locked behind a 30x playthrough. That translates to £1,800 in turnover before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. Even if you’re a seasoned spinner on Starburst, which spins so fast you’d think the reels were on a treadmill, the maths stay unforgiving.
- Deposit: £25
- Credit after bonus: £60
- Wagering requirement: 30x (£1,800)
- Typical win‑rate on volatile slots: 96% RTP
Because the required turnover dwarfs the bonus, most players end up losing the original £25 and a bit more. The casino’s profit margin is baked into that requirement, not into some mystical “luck” factor.

What the Savvy Player Should Watch For
First, read the fine print. Look for hidden clauses about maximum bet size, restricted games, and time limits. A common trap: you’re barred from betting more than £2 per spin while the bonus is active. That restriction drags the turnover out longer, increasing the chance you’ll run out of cash before satisfying the condition.
Second, calculate the effective cost. If the bonus is £35 and you need to wager 30x, you’re effectively paying £1,050 in “play” for a £35 extra bankroll. Divide that by the average return‑to‑player (RTP) of your favourite slots, and you’ll see the house edge is magnified.
Third, compare offers across operators. Some sites waive the wagering requirement entirely for “no deposit” bonuses, but they cap the cashout at a modest £10. Others, like Betway, will give you a 100% match up to £100, but with a 40x playthrough. The raw numbers decide which promotion, if any, is tolerable – not the glossy marketing copy.
